The Biggest Mid-Year Gaming Event Kicks Off in June

On January 30, Summer Game Fest announced its return on Twitter and it’s going to happen on June 6-9, 2025, in Los Angeles, California.

According to the Twitter post by Summer Game Fest, this year’s event will happen in YouTube Theater in LA where the last two events happened. This year, there will be more than 40 leading game publishers joining Geoff ready to announce what they’re cooking for the year and beyond.

Even if E3 is already dead, its spirit is still alive with game companies and publishers often taking June as the time to announce their upcoming games. The biggest platform for most publishers is Geoff Keighley’s Summer Game Fest as its viewership can easily go past 1 million.

Summer Game Fest has been successful in each of its shows, often showcasing huge games that fans have been waiting for. Past games that were showcased in the event were:

  • Elden Ring
  • Black Myth: Wukong
  • Monster Hunter Stories Remaster
  • Palworld
  • Tales of Arise
  • Escape from Tarkov
  • Payday 3

Summer Game Fest was Geoff Keighley’s answer to the cancelation of E3 2020 citing E3’s changes to its approach as something he doesn’t “feel comfortable participating”. Since then, Summer Game Fest has replaced E3 with the latter shutting down in December of 2024.

Summer Game Fest will be streamed on YouTube and Twitch.
